ARMv8.4 adds the mandatory FEAT_TLBIOS and FEAT_TLBIRANGE. They provides TLBI maintenance instructions that extend to the Outer Shareable domain and that apply to a range of input addresses. Changes from v1 to v2:
o Split new instructions into different ARMCPRegInfo sections, and only add them if ID_AA64ISAR0.TLB indicates they're supported. o Improve the performance of the new code in cputlb.c.
